Qualitätsschaumwein bestimmter Anbaugebiete, QbA



Qualitätsschaumwein bestimmter Anbaugebiete or short QbA is a category in German wine classification. Sparkling wines with these labels must be produced in certain areas of Germany and the grapes must have a specific ripeness. In the classification of German sparkling wines QbA is the third category from the top. It has to contain 100 % of Qualitätsweine bestimmter Anbaugebiete. The category can be compared to the Italian DOC and the French AOC.
